I want to travel around the world for fun,
And see different lands, one by one.
But I would not like to travel by aeroplane, train, or by car -
I would like to have a magic carpet that will take me afar.
I will keep the carpet under my bed, rolled upright,
So it will be easy to reach, when I want to take flight.
I won’t need to get a passport, or buy a ticket when I want to fly,
I’ll just sit on my magic carpet, and wave everyone good-bye!
I’ll cross rivers and valleys, and the snowy Himalayas so tall,
And fly to faraway China to see the Great Wall.
Then I’ll float to Egypt, and visit the great Nile,
And see the pyramids, and the Sphinx’s mysterious smile.
I’ll travel to the African jungles where wild animals roam,
And visit European cities like London, Paris, and Rome
But on my magic carpet, before I eagerly set out,
There’s something that I’m a little worried about.
I keep thinking of it, again and again –
What will happen if my magic carpet gets caught in the rain?
I’m sure that soaking wet carpets can’t fly far away -
So, to travel for fun, I must find another way!
